Who is Luke’s twin?

In the Star Wars franchise, the main character, Luke Skywalker, has a twin sister named Leia Organa. They were separated shortly after their birth when their father, Anakin Skywalker, turned to the dark side of the Force and became Darth Vader. Leia was adopted by the Royal Family of Alderaan and raised as a princess, while Luke was raised by his aunt and uncle on the desert planet of Tatooine.

As the story progresses, Luke, Leia and their allies fight against the tyrannical rule of the Galactic Empire and work to restore peace to the galaxy. It is revealed that Leia, like Luke, has a strong connection to the Force and is also capable of becoming a Jedi. In fact, Leia learns of her true parentage and Force abilities in the third movie of the original trilogy, Return of the Jedi.

The relationship between Luke and Leia is a central theme in the Star Wars franchise, as their bond as siblings is ultimately what leads to the defeat of the Empire. The two also share a close emotional connection, with Luke risking his life to rescue his sister from danger and Leia supporting Luke as he struggles to learn and master the ways of the Force.

Luke Skywalker’s twin sister is Leia Organa. Together, they fight for the greater good of the galaxy and share a deep bond as siblings.
